Service Care Solutions are currently working alongside an popular local authority, based in Lancashire, which is seeking an experienced Planning and Highway Solicitor to join their team. This is an excellent opportunity to progress in your career and gain experience in the legal industry.

This role pays a competitive rate of £45-£50 an hour umbrella depending on experience.

This role is on a contract basis for 3 months but has potential to extend.

Responsibilities as a Planning and Highway Solicitor:

  • Analyse and interpret planning documents, zoning laws, and environmental regulations.
  • Able to handle high caseload in Planning and Highway from start to completion.
  • Prepare planning appeal documents and submissions to relevant planning authorities.
  • To attend at Licensing, Planning, and other committees where legal advice and support is required to keep the Council safe from making unlawful decisions

About you as a Planning and Highway Solicitor:

  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Powerful understanding of planning laws, zoning regulations, land use policies, and highway regulations.
  • Effective attention to detail and organisational abilities.
